Admissions Counselor, School of Adult and Community Education – Detroit, Michigan  Admissions Director, Admissions Weber and School of Adult and Community Education Programs

 
Scope of Responsibilities: To act as a face-to-face and online representative of Grace College Detroit to prospective and currently enrolled students for School of Adult and Community Education in Detroit, Michigan. Through relationship building, an Admissions Counselor’s goal is to guide prospective students from through inquiry to admission and will cultivate relationships with organizations to identify potential students for the adult programs. Additionally, the Admissions Counselor will assist in providing student services to Weber and GOAL students as they transition to an enrollment status.
 
General Responsibilities: Duties: Interact and answer direct questions to prospective students interested in adult educational degrees. Complete daily contact flow for adult programs in EX. Speak to individuals and groups in prepared and impromptu presentations, answering questions and providing literature. Work with all individuals at Grace College Detroit to facilitate productive visits for potential students. Work with Weber associate degree students and GOAL students interested in the degree completion program answering questions and assisting with the application process, and providing input through the admissions decisions. Respond to prospective student emails and phone calls and other mediums in less than 24 hours. Assist with processing student application decisions including transcript evaluations. Provide assistance to data entry by providing needed information, maintaining thorough notes in EX, and collecting application parts. Cooperate with marketing to provide information necessary to create collateral and publicize new and existing programs. Operates school and rental vehicles with valid driver’s license and have an excellent driving record. Assist with student orientation programs. Provide some assistance as needed to student services such as the Business Office, Registrar, Financial Aid and faculty members. Work on building relationships with local human resource directors, community colleges and other key constituents to expand and promote Grace College’s adult programs. Serve as a member of the School of Adult and Community Education Admissions team to develop and implement effective admissions strategies. Attend college fairs and visit local businesses to promote the Weber and GOAL programs in Detroit. Performs other duties as assigned.
 
Minimum Qualifications: Bachelor’s degree in Business, Marketing, Project Management, Communication, or related field. Proficient experience with the Microsoft Office Suite. A highly self-motivated individual with outgoing personality, excellent social skills and likeable personality. Have a team-player mentality. Must be punctual and good at following oral directions. Must have superior oral and written communication skills and a natural style of relating that puts others at ease quickly. Must be comfortable talking to individuals and groups, many times impromptu; therefore, should be good at “thinking on one’s feet.” Must be a good listener, able to sift through questions and address issues in a relevant way. Available for evening and weekend work (usually from home). Must have a notable Christian faith and commitment.
 
Preferred Qualifications: One year of experience in related field, marketing or communications. Experience with adult education.
 
Status: Full Time, Exempt
